When something becomes obvious, it means that the matter or situation at hand is now clear and evident to the perception. There is no ambiguity left, and the fact or reality is easily understood or recognized. This could apply to a wide range of contexts, from understanding a concept, noticing a pattern, or recognizing the truth in a given situation.
